Our Aftercare Options
After your pet has passed, we continue to provide support by managing all aftercare arrangements with dignity. We partner with trusted local professionals to offer respectful cremation services, handling every detail according to your wishes.
You may choose the option that feels right for you:
Communal Cremation: Your pet is cremated with other cherished pets, and their ashes are scattered respectfully.
Private Cremation: Your pet is cremated individually, and their ashes are carefully returned to you in an urn of your choice as a timeless memorial.

What to expect:
Our promise is to create a serene and supportive experience for your family. When our veterinarian arrives at your Hamilton home, she will begin by explaining the process and answering all of your questions. We proceed at your family’s pace, ensuring you have all the time you need for your final moments together.
The procedure consists of two injections. The first is a sedative that allows your pet to drift into a deep and comfortable sleep, free from any pain. Once your pet is fully sedated and your family has said their goodbyes, the final injection is administered to allow them to pass away peacefully. The entire process is humane and designed to feel like a gentle transition.

What is included in the cost?
The cost for the visit will vary depending on the size of your pet, the distance driven, and other factors such as the need for additional time or medications. The in-home euthanasia service includes the veterinary visit to your home, a brief assessment, and the sedation & euthanasia procedure. Additionally, based on your aftercare selection, the cost may include, cremation or aquamation, transportation, and keepsakes.

How long does the appointment take?
We understand this is a tender time. Your veterinarian will be present in your home for 20-60 minutes, allowing ample space and time for you to say goodbye and be with your companion in a way that feels most comfortable and peaceful.
Will the vet take my pet with them after the appointment?
During your appointment, the vet will confirm your aftercare selection. If you opt for cremation or aquamation services, the vet will handle your pet’s transportation from your home and will care for your pet’s body until they are respectfully transferred to the appointed aftercare provider.
Are you available for emergencies?
Peaceful Passing’s priority is to accommodate our patients and we can usually have a veterinarian available for same day emergency visits. However, Peaceful Passing is not a 24 hour emergency service. If this is a serious emergency, we recommend contacting your regular veterinary clinic or the nearest veterinary emergency facility.
